Output 8d2430454f99cd651449c941a2350e6f96ae2d41b81e26bf60b718d255d6f43c:0

value
1344224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17164166c0d27df24ef3a451bf593dde57da5112 OP_EQUAL
address
33o68Hxw8xfXH5W8nv93vKU3HU8nfCYrFz
transaction
8d2430454f99cd651449c941a2350e6f96ae2d41b81e26bf60b718d255d6f43c
confirmations
388493
spent
true